Torsion Spring Replacement
Most common type, mounted above the door. These springs use torque to lift heavy garage doors safely.
- Longer lifespan (15,000-20,000 cycles)
- Better balance and smoother operation
- Safer and more reliable
- Ideal for heavier doors
Extension Spring Repair
Mounted on both sides of the door, these springs extend and contract as the door moves.
- More affordable option
- Common in older garage doors
- Easier to identify when broken
- Quick replacement process
Warning Signs Your Spring is Broken
If you notice any of these signs, contact us immediately +1 (973) 929-7888
Door Won’t Open
Your garage door won’t open fully or is extremely heavy to lift manually
Loud Bang
You heard a loud snap or bang coming from your garage
Crooked Door
The door hangs unevenly or appears crooked when opening
Visible Gap
You can see a gap or separation in the spring above the door
Door Slams Down
The door closes too quickly or slams shut
Opener Struggles
Your opener runs but the door barely moves

Can I replace a garage door spring myself?
We strongly advise against DIY spring replacement. Garage door springs are under extreme tension and can cause serious injury or death if handled improperly. Professional installation ensures safety and proper function.
Should I replace both springs at once?
Yes, we recommend replacing both springs even if only one is broken. Springs age at the same rate, so if one breaks, the other is likely to fail soon. Replacing both saves money and prevents future emergencies.
How long do garage door springs last?
Torsion springs typically last 15,000-20,000 cycles (about 7-10 years with average use). Extension springs last about 10,000 cycles. We offer high-cycle springs that can last significantly longer.
